Output 3ec6f5966c7de09660c9fdffbcb204bca59e0bdd9e75c5e3c67705fed618ec4c:2

value
299205161
script pubkey
OP_0 OP_PUSHBYTES_32 0cd6ae3ea55dd9f55429c8d9c5768d998580c4a0f5dfc5fea19e30e2dcafada6
address
bc1qpnt2u049thvl24pfervu2a5dnxzcp39q7h0utl4pnccw9h904knqnqkalu
transaction
3ec6f5966c7de09660c9fdffbcb204bca59e0bdd9e75c5e3c67705fed618ec4c
spent
true